[發明專利]SOC芯片的調試方法和調試系統有效
| 申請號: | 201110390423.5 | 申請日: | 2011-11-30 |
| 公開(公告)號: | CN102495781A | 公開(公告)日: | 2012-06-13 |
| 發明(設計)人: | 徐衛 | 申請(專利權)人: | 青島海信信芯科技有限公司 |
| 主分類號: | G06F11/26 | 分類號: | G06F11/26;G06F13/20 |
| 代理公司: | 北京友聯知識產權代理事務所(普通合伙) 11343 | 代理人: | 尚志峰;汪海屏 |
| 地址: | 266100 山*** | 國省代碼: | 山東;37 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| soc 芯片 調試 方法 系統 | ||
技術領域
本發明涉及SOC芯片的調試技術,具體而言,涉及SOC芯片的調試方法和調試系統。
背景技術
SOC(System-on-a-chip,片上系統)視頻處理芯片是都整合了很多IP資源的集合體,包括CPU、VIDEO?DECODER以及許多視頻處理模塊。在芯片整體架構搭建完畢之后,需要有一個統一的調試方法來對芯片內的所有模塊以及系統軟件進行調試。一般常見的調試接口有USB(Universal?Serial?BUS,通用串行總線)、JTAG(Joint?Test?Action?Group,聯合測試行為組織)等,但是這些調試方式需要購買一套調試工具以及調試開發環境,這種套件往往比較昂貴。但是SOC芯片中一般都具有硬件的UART(Universal?Asynchronous?Receiver/Transmitter,通用異步接收/發送裝置)接口,通過這種簡單的通信接口將調試指令傳送到芯片中,從而不需要專門的調試工具,甚至可以自行開發,降低調試成本。
因此,需要一種新的SOC芯片的調試技術,可以由UART接口實現對SOC芯片的調試,極大地降低了調試過程的費用。
發明內容
為了解決上述技術問題至少之一,本發明提供了一種新的SOC芯片的調試技術,可以由UART接口實現對SOC芯片的調試,極大地降低了調試過程的費用,同時,采用圖形用戶界面接收操作指令,從而生成調試命令,便于實現對SOC芯片的批處理,提升調試效率。
有鑒于此,本發明提出了一種SOC芯片的調試方法,包括:步驟102,將所述SOC芯片通過UART接口連接至電平轉換裝置,并將所述電平轉換裝置連接至控制主機;步驟104,所述控制主機將通過圖形用戶界面接收到的調試操作指令生成調試命令;步驟106,所述電平轉換裝置對所述調試命令進行電平轉換,生成電平轉換調試命令;步驟108,所述SOC芯片獲取并運行所述電平轉換調試命令。
在該技術方案中,利用了SOC芯片上的UART接口,相比于USB或是JTAG,UART接口更為通用。在使用USB或JTAG等調試接口時,則需要對應的專門的一套調試工具及調試開發環境,但具有USB或JTAG等調試接口的SOC芯片的數量只占小部分,因而添置的調試工具及調試開發環境可以使用的范圍遠小于基于UART接口的調試套件,因而對于UART接口的利用,可以大大降低調試過程的費用。
這里的電平轉換裝置,比如TTL電平轉換芯片,主要是由于對UART接口和RS-232接口的利用,從而在將調試命令從控制主機發送至SOC芯片上時,需要對信號的電平進行調整。其中,RS-232接口用于連接控制主機和電平轉換裝置,從而對應于UART接口,實現信號傳輸過程中的電平轉換,確保信號的成功傳輸。
這里的圖形用戶界面是被安裝在控制主機上的一套調試環境,通過圖形化的方式,在人機交互界面上顯示出調試界面,則用戶可以在該調試界面上對SOC芯片上需要進行調試的功能模塊或是寄存器進行選擇,以及對希望進行的調試方式進行選擇,然后由控制主機將圖形用戶界面接收到的調試指令,生成對應的調試命令,其中,對應于SOC芯片上的各個功能模塊,已經提前對其地址進行了定義,因而能夠同時將調試命令應用于用戶希望進行調試的模塊,并得到對應的調試結果,實現對SOC芯片上的功能模塊或是寄存器的批處理。
根據本發明的又一方面,還提出了一種SOC芯片的調試系統,包括:所述SOC芯片、電平轉換裝置和控制主機,其中,所述控制主機,連接至所述電平轉換裝置,包含圖形用戶界面,具體包括:指令接收單元,通過所述圖形用戶界面接收所述用戶的所述調試操作指令;生成單元,根據所述指令接收單元接收到的所述調試操作指令,生成調試命令;發送單元,將所述調試命令發送至所述電平轉換裝置;所述電平轉換裝置,通過UART接口連接至所述SOC芯片,包括:傳送單元,從所述控制主機獲取所述調試命令,或將生成的電平轉換調試命令發送至所述SOC芯片;電平轉換單元,對來自所述傳送單元的所述調試命令進行電平轉換,生成所述電平轉換調試命令;所述SOC芯片,包括:命令接收單元,通過所述UART接口接收來自所述電平轉換裝置的所述電平轉換調試命令;運行單元,運行所述電平轉換調試命令。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于青島海信信芯科技有限公司,未經青島海信信芯科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201110390423.5/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種環冷機烘爐裝置
- 下一篇:采用地毯面料制成的箱包





